Text
(a)Before a unit awards any procurement contract for an amount above $500,000, the recommended awardee may be required to submit a workforce diversity plan to the procurement officer.
(b)Before a unit awards any procurement contract for an amount above $250,000, the recommended awardee may be required to submit a supplier diversity plan to the procurement officer.
(c)The Governor’s Office of Small, Minority, and Women Business Affairs in consultation with the Office of State Procurement shall adopt regulations to carry out this section that include:
(1)suggested content to be included in a workforce or supplier diversity plan; and
(2)guidance for units to comply with the requirements of this section.
